Nettet25. jan. 2024 · The first thing to know is that crawl spaces cost a bit more money than slab foundations. On average, crawl space foundations cost between $5 and $16 per square foot. By comparison, slab foundations generally cost between $4 and $14 per square foot. So if you’re looking for the least expensive option, it’s best to go with a slab foundation. NettetHow to Dispose of Building Materials Containing Asbestos. Here are the code requirements for unvented crawl spaces. The earth must be covered by a Class I vapor barrier. Where barriers overlap, the seams must overlap by 6 inches and be sealed. The barrier must extend at least 6 inches up the walls of the crawl space and be sealed to …

NettetThe head height is usually the first step in changing a crawl space to a basement because it’s the one that requires the most work. Most crawl spaces are usually about 4 feet tall, so you’ll have to come up with at least 3 more feet of additional head space. There are two options to achieve this goal.
